Multistate Bar Examination Practice Question

Jordan has a one-year lease for a residential apartment. Ten months into the lease, he informs his landlord, Taylor, that he will be relocating for work and intends to vacate the property in one month. In response, Taylor ends the lease and secures a new tenant to occupy the apartment for the remaining two months. Jordan contends that Taylor should have maintained the lease until its original end date or provided an alternative arrangement. What is Taylor's correct legal position regarding the termination of the lease and securing a new tenant?

  • Taylor allows Jordan to remain on the lease until the original termination date.

  • Taylor terminates the lease without seeking a replacement tenant.

  • Taylor offers Jordan a reduced rent for the remaining lease period.

  • Taylor mitigated potential damages by obtaining a new tenant after Jordan ended the lease early.
